声音处理设备和输入声音处理方法

文档序号:2822444阅读:188来源:国知局
专利名称:声音处理设备和输入声音处理方法
技术领域
本发明涉及声音处理设备和用于其的方法,更具体地说,本发明涉及用于消除输入噪声的设备、用于该设备的方法和用于该设备的计算机程序产品。
背景技术
在诸如麦克风之类的具有音频输入单元的电子设备中,各种噪声单独或者与所期望的音频一起被输入到音频输入单元中。这些各种噪声包括由于操作电子设备所导致的噪声。在诸如蜂窝电话之类的便携式通信设备中,麦克风被设置得接近按键操作单元。因此,由于按键操作所产生的声音可能被输入到麦克风中,并且被发送到通信对端。
例如,JP3,420,831 B和JP60-173600 A每个都公开了一种方法,用于抑止和消除通过麦克风输入的噪声。其他已知的方法包括从输入的声音中提取噪声,并且生成具有与所述噪声相反相位的声波,从而抑止噪声。
然而,已知的噪声消除处理增加了声音数据处理所需要的时间。换言之,由于噪声消除处理所需要的时间而使声音数据处理延迟了。

发明内容
本发明的一个目的是提供一种下述声音处理设备和用于其的方法,所述声音处理设备能够减少伴随噪声消除处理的声音数据处理所要求的处理时间。
为了实现上述目的,根据本发明的一个方面,提供了一种声音处理设备,其包括输入声音分割装置,用于将输入声音分割为预定时间单元;输入声音编码装置,用于对如上所述分割的输入声音进行编码;噪声检测装置;和输出控制装置,用于根据所述噪声检测装置的检测结果用无声数据替换关于所述输入声音的编码数据。
根据本发明的另一个方面,提供了一种声音处理设备,其包括声音输入单元,用于将输入声音分割为预定时间单元;声音处理单元,用于对如上所述分割的输入声音进行编码;噪声检测单元;和输出控制单元,用于根据所述噪声检测单元的检测结果用无声数据替换关于所述输入声音的编码数据。
根据本发明的另一个方面,提供了一种输入声音处理方法,其包括编码输入声音;判断所述输入声音是否包含噪声;和用无声数据替换在所述编码的输入声音中包含的噪声部分。
根据本发明的另一个方面,提供了一种计算机可读介质中的计算机程序产品,用于声音处理设备中,所述计算机程序产品包括下述步骤编码输入声音;判断所述输入声音是否包含噪声;和用无声数据替换在所述编码的输入声音中包含的噪声部分。
根据上述的本发明,即使执行噪声消除处理也不会增加声音数据处理所要求的时间,这不同于传统技术。


当结合附图时,从下面的详细描述本发明的上述和其他目的、特征和优点将变清楚,其中图1是其中根据本发明实施方式的声音处理设备被应用到便携式通信终端的示例的框图;图2示出了根据图1所示的实施方式的声音处理设备中的处理的处理时间;图3是根据本发明另一实施方式的声音处理设备的框图;图4是根据本发明另一实施方式的声音处理设备的框图;图5是根据本发明另一实施方式的声音处理设备的框图;图6示出了其中根据本发明的声音处理设备被应用到音频记录设备的配置示例。
具体实施例方式
在下文中,将描述根据本发明优选实施方式的声音处理设备。图1示出了一种示例,其中,根据本发明实施例的声音处理设备1被用于诸如蜂窝电话之类的便携式通信终端。声音处理设备1包括声音输入单元10、声音处理单元20、按键操作检测单元30和输出控制单元40。通信单元50和按键输入单元60是便携式通信终端的构成组件。声音输入单元10将输入的音频数据分割为被称作帧的预定时间单元(处理1),并且将这些帧发送到声音处理单元20(处理2)。声音处理单元20对从声音输入单元10接收到的帧进行编码(处理3),并且将这些帧发送到输出控制单元40(处理4)。按键操作检测单元30检测按键输入单元60的按键操作(处理5),并且向输出控制单元40通知检测结果(处理6)。换言之,按键操作检测单元30是一种噪声检测单元。声音处理设备1识别出由于按键操作噪声正被输入声音输入单元10。基于从按键操作检测单元30发送来的检测结果,输出控制单元40选择自声音处理单元20接收到的编码的数据帧,或者由输出控制单元40预先编码的无声帧(silent frame)(处理7)。具体地说,当按键操作检测单元30检测到按键操作时,输出控制单元40用无声帧替换编码的数据帧,并且将该无声帧发送给通信单元50。在按键操作检测单元30未检测出按键操作时,输出控制单元40将编码的数据帧发送给通信单元50。
图2示出了声音处理设备1内的处理的处理时间。当便携式通信终端的输入按键(即,按键输入单元60)被操作时,诸如按键声之类的噪声在t1时刻被输入到声音输入单元10中。按键操作检测单元30电检测诸如按键按下之类的操作(处理5)。按键操作检测单元30在时刻t2处检测出按键操作,或者在从噪声产生起经过预定时间后检测出按键操作。然而,在按键操作检测单元30中的处理(处理5和6)所需要的时间一般比在声音输入单元10和声音处理单元20中的处理(处理1到4)所需要的时间短。因此,输入声音编码处理和噪声(即,按键操作声)检测处理被并行执行。编码的数据帧和按键操作检测结果几乎同时到达输出控制单元40。因此,这防止了由于噪声检测/消除处理而使处理输入的声音所要求的时间变得较长。另外,不必从输入的声音信号中检测由于按键按下所产生的噪声,从而实现了简单的声音处理设备和用于其的方法。
图3示出了根据本发明另一实施例的声音处理设备。声音处理设备1具有替换按键操作检测单元30的噪声检测单元70。噪声检测单元70利用已知的声音处理(处理5`)从输入的声音中检测噪声。类似于上述实施方式,声音输入单元10将输入的声音转换为帧,并且将这些帧发送给声音处理单元20和噪声检测单元70。因此,噪声检测处理和声音编码处理彼此独立地被并行执行。这些处理需要基本相同的时间。一旦接收到来自噪声检测单元70的噪声检测,与上述实施方式类似,输出控制单元40用无声帧来替换输入声音的编码数据帧(噪声帧)。在本实施例中,也防止了由于噪声检测处理而使处理输入的声音所要求的时间变得较长。
图4示出了根据本发明另一实施例的声音处理设备。在图4所示的声音处理设备1中,噪声存储器单元80被添加到图3所示的声音处理设备1中。噪声存储器单元80保存关于由输入按键所产生的各种按键声的数据。通过参考该数据,噪声检测单元70可以快速轻易地检测出噪声。噪声存储器单元80可以保存关于由噪声检测单元70检测出的噪声的数据。另外,可以预先收集由操作按键所产生的各种按键声,并且将这些声音存储在噪声存储器单元80中。另外,在本实施方式中,处理1到4、5`、6和7与图1和图3所示的实施方式中的那些处理相同。噪声存储器单元80允许声音处理设备1进一步减少声音数据处理所要求的时间。
图5示出了根据另一实施例的声音处理设备。在检测出了输入按键(按键输入单元60)操作,并且从发送自声音输入单元10的输入声音数据中检测出了噪声之后,噪声检测单元70将噪声数据发送给噪声存储器单元80。在本实施方式中,处理1到4、5`、6和7也与图1和图3所示的实施方式的操作相同。通过参考噪声存储器单元80中的噪声数据,噪声检测单元70可以轻易地检测出噪声。在本实施方式中,噪声存储器单元80在声音处理设备1操作的同时自动积累关于各种噪声的数据。本实施例不需要专门的操作用来使噪声存储器单元80在其中存储数据。
图6示出了其中上述声音处理设备1被应用于音频记录设备的示例。图1所示的声音处理设备1的输出控制单元40将声音数据输出到存储器单元90,而不是到通信单元50。在这种情形中,声音数据中的噪声数据(诸如按键声)被用无声数据替换了。在本实施方式中,处理1到4、5`、6和7也与上述实施方式的处理相同。
上述声音处理设备1可以包括控制单元(未示出)。在控制单元中可以设置下述至少一个声音输入单元10、声音处理单元20、按键操作检测单元30、输出控制单元40、噪声检测单元70和噪声存储器单元80。
本发明可以被应用到蜂窝电话、无线电通信设备、音频记录设备等。
尽管已结合某些优选实施方式描述了本发明,但是,应当理解,本发明所包括的主题不限于这些特定的实施方式。相反,其是要包括可以被包括在所附权利要求的精神和范围内的所有替换、修改和等同。
此外,发明人是要保有所要求的发明的所有等同,即使在审查期间修改了权利要求。
权利要求
1.一种声音处理设备,包括输入声音分割装置,用于将输入声音分割为预定时间单元;输入声音编码装置,用于对如上所述分割的输入声音进行编码;噪声检测装置;和输出控制装置,用于根据所述噪声检测装置的检测结果用无声数据替换关于所述输入声音的编码数据。
2.一种声音处理设备,包括声音输入单元,用于将输入声音分割为预定时间单元;声音处理单元,用于对如上所述分割的输入声音进行编码;噪声检测单元;和输出控制单元,用于根据所述噪声检测单元的检测结果用无声数据替换关于所述输入声音的编码数据。
3.如权利要求2所述的声音处理设备,其被设置在具有按键操作单元的设备中,其中,所述噪声检测单元基于对按键操作的检测判断出所述输入声音是噪声。
4.如权利要求3所述的声音处理设备,其中,所述输入声音是由于所述按键操作而产生的。
5.如权利要求2所述的声音处理设备,其中,所述噪声检测单元检测所述输入声音中的噪声。
6.如权利要求2所述的声音处理设备,还包括存储噪声的噪声存储器单元。
7.如权利要求6所述的声音处理设备,其中,一旦检测到所述输入声音中的噪声,所述噪声检测单元就将所述噪声输出到所述噪声存储器单元。
8.如权利要求6所述的声音处理设备,其中,所述噪声检测单元参考所述噪声存储器单元中存储的所述噪声来检测所述输入声音中的噪声。
9.如权利要求6所述的声音处理设备,其被设置在具有按键操作单元的设备中,其中,所述噪声检测单元基于对按键操作的检测判断出所述输入声音是噪声,并且将所述噪声输出到所述噪声存储器单元。
10.如权利要求2所述的声音处理设备,其被设置在便携式通信终端中。
11.如权利要求10所述的声音处理设备,其中,所述输出控制单元将数据发送给所述便携式通信终端的通信单元。
12.如权利要求2所述的声音处理设备,其被设置在音频记录设备中。
13.如权利要求12所述的声音处理设备,其中,所述输出控制单元将数据发送给所述音频记录设备的存储器单元。
14.一种输入声音处理方法,包括下述步骤编码输入声音;判断所述输入声音是否包含噪声;和用无声数据替换在所述编码的输入声音中包含的噪声部分。
15.如权利要求14所述的输入声音处理方法,其中,所述编码输入声音的步骤和所述判断所述输入声音是否包含噪声的步骤被并行执行。
16.如权利要求14所述的输入声音处理方法,其中,一旦接收到按键操作通知,所述输入声音就被判断为包含噪声。
17.如权利要求16所述的输入声音处理方法,其中,所述输入声音是由于所述按键操作而产生的。
18.如权利要求14所述的输入声音处理方法,还包括存储包含在所述输入声音中的噪声。
19.如权利要求18所述的输入声音处理方法,其中,所述判断所述输入声音是否包含噪声的步骤是通过参考所述所存储的噪声而被执行的。
20.一种计算机可读介质中的计算机程序产品,用于声音处理设备中,所述计算机程序产品包括下述步骤编码输入声音;判断所述输入声音是否包含噪声;和用无声数据替换在所述编码的输入声音中包含的噪声部分。
21.如权利要求20所述的计算机程序产品,其中,所述编码输入声音的步骤和所述判断所述输入声音是否包含噪声的步骤被并行执行。
22.如权利要求20所述的计算机程序产品,还包括检测按键操作的步骤,其中,一旦检测到按键操作,所述输入声音就被判断为包含噪声。
全文摘要
本发明提供了一种声音处理设备和输入声音处理方法。声音处理设备包括声音输入单元,用于将输入声音分割为预定时间单元;声音处理单元,用于对如上所述分割的输入声音进行编码;噪声检测单元;和输出控制单元,用于根据噪声检测单元的检测结果用无声数据替换关于输入声音的编码数据。输入声音处理方法包括编码输入声音;判断所述输入声音是否包含噪声;和用无声数据替换在编码的输入声音中包含的噪声部分。
文档编号G10L21/02GK1741133SQ200510093098
公开日2006年3月1日 申请日期2005年8月25日 优先权日2004年8月27日
发明者根本京, 细川知志 申请人:日本电气株式会社
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1